408Logica Universalis: Towards a General Theory of Logic (edited book)Birkhäuser Basel. 2007.Universal Logic is not a new logic, but a general theory of logics, considered as mathematical structures. The name was introduced about ten years ago, but the subject is as old as the beginning of modern logic: Alfred Tarski and other Polish logicians such as Adolf Lindenbaum developed a general theory of logics at the end of the 1920s based on consequence operations and logical matrices. 19Truth as a Mathematical Object DOI:10.5007/1808-1711.2010v14n1p31Principia: An International Journal of Epistemology 14 (1): 31-46. 2010.In this paper we discuss in which sense truth is considered as a mathematical object in propositional logic. After clarifying how this concept is used in classical logic, through the notions of truth-table, truth-function and bivaluation, we examine some generalizations of it in non-classical logics: many-valued matrix semantics with three and four values, non-truth-functional bivalent semantics, Kripke possible world semantics. • DOI:10.5007/1808-1711.2010v14n1p31.

70The paraconsistent logic Z. A possible solution to Jaśkowski's problemLogic and Logical Philosophy 15 (2): 99-111. 2006.We present a paraconsistent logic, called Z, based on an intuitive possible worlds semantics, in which the replacement theorem holds. We show how to axiomatize this logic and prove the completeness theorem

89Classical negation can be expressed by one of its halvesLogic Journal of the IGPL 7 (2): 145-151. 1999.We present the logic K/2 which is a logic with classical implication and only the left part of classical negation.We show that it is possible to define a classical negation into K/2 and that the classical proposition logic K can be translated into this apparently weaker logic.We use concepts from model-theory in order to characterized rigorously this translation and to understand this paradox.
